Colts Are Latest NFL Team Hit With Positive COVID-19 Tests

The Colts are the latest NFL team to "close their facility after receiving word of positive COVID-19 tests." The team this morning announced that they "will be working remotely as they work to confirm that those tests are true positives." The Colts are scheduled to host the Bengals on Sunday, but "any plans for that game are going to be tentative until the confirmation process comes to an end." The Bengals have a bye in Week 9 and the Colts have a bye in Week 7, so "any move from this Sunday would take some schedule shuffling by the league" (PROFOOTBALLTALK.com, 10/16).
